PowerProtect: PPDM Oracle backups fail with: AppBackupAssetsOp: Backup failed with error Process /home/oracle/opt/dpsapps/rmanagent/bin/ddbmcon failed with error code -6, stdout data: , stderr data: ..

Summary: Este artículo ofrece una solución alternativa para el siguiente problema. Se produce una falla de respaldo debido a que el usuario del sistema operativo configurado para realizar respaldos no tiene permiso para acceder a las bibliotecas del lado del cliente de Oracle. ...

This article applies to This article does not apply to This article is not tied to any specific product. Not all product versions are identified in this article.

Symptoms

Los respaldos de Oracle fallan después de un parche o una actualización de Oracle. Se muestra el siguiente mensaje.
 
AppBackupAssetsOp: Backup failed with error Process /home/oracle/opt/dpsapps/rmanagent/bin/ddbmcon failed with error code -6, stdout data: , stderr data: ..


ddbmcon log muestra el siguiente error cuando se conecta a la base de datos
 
[TRACE_ID:a8d14cc3ba61af79;JOB_ID:807baa3f0ebb6ac1;EXEC_ID:900b0d63c550ebd6] ddbmcon: build machine = linux86w
[TRACE_ID:a8d14cc3ba61af79;JOB_ID:807baa3f0ebb6ac1;EXEC_ID:900b0d63c550ebd6] ddbmcon: Oracle library: /opt/oracle/product/19.0.0/dbhome_1/lib64/libclntsh.so not found.
[TRACE_ID:a8d14cc3ba61af79;JOB_ID:807baa3f0ebb6ac1;EXEC_ID:900b0d63c550ebd6] ddbmcon: Oracle library: /opt/oracle/product/19.0.0/dbhome_1/lib/libclntsh.so not found.
[TRACE_ID:a8d14cc3ba61af79;JOB_ID:807baa3f0ebb6ac1;EXEC_ID:900b0d63c550ebd6] ddbmcon: Please verify correct ORACLE_HOME.
[TRACE_ID:a8d14cc3ba61af79;JOB_ID:807baa3f0ebb6ac1;EXEC_ID:900b0d63c550ebd6] ddbmcon: ====auth:1 dbver:19====failing with sysbkp oci authmode====


Cause

Oracle se actualizó/parchó y el usuario del sistema operativo configurado para realizar el respaldo no tiene permisos para abrir las siguientes bibliotecas de clientes de Oracle
 
-rwx------. 1 oracle oinstall   2247120 Apr 14 03:38 libasmclntsh19.so
-rwx------. 1 oracle oinstall   8056664 Apr 14 03:38 libclntshcore.so.19.1
-rw-------. 1 oracle oinstall   1771463 Apr 14 03:38 clntshcore.map
-rwx------. 1 oracle oinstall  81182280 Apr 14 03:38 libclntsh.so.19.1
-rw-------. 1 oracle oinstall   6165285 Apr 14 03:38 clntsh.map
PPDM debe poder abrir las bibliotecas de clientes de Oracle anteriores para poder conectarse a la base de datos de Oracle.

Resolution

Cambie los permisos a las bibliotecas de clientes de Oracle para que el usuario de Oracle tenga permiso para abrirlas y conectarse a la base de datos de Oracle.
 
Ejemplo:
chmod 755 *clnt*
Lo anterior es solo un ejemplo. Consulte el DBA antes de cambiar los permisos en las bibliotecas de Oracle.
Article Properties
Article Number: 000212641
Article Type: Solution
Last Modified: 25 May 2023
Version:  2
Find answers to your questions from other Dell users
Support Services
Check if your device is covered by Support Services.